You can take as many toiletries as you want

Some people think they’re sneaky when they grab small bars of soap, shampoo and conditioner samples, and other toilet articles and hide them in their purses. They don’t realize that the hotel staff leaves complimentary toiletries in their bathrooms for a reason—they expect you to take each of those things with you.

Hotels often throw away half-used toiletries because they can’t reuse them with future guests. Besides, they work as free advertising if they feature the hotel’s logo on the side. However, that doesn’t mean you can take home robes or towels from the bathroom; that’d be considered stealing, and you might get in trouble.
